ENR Mountain States & Southwest is compiling its annual Top Design Firms list, which will be published in the June 23 issue of the magazine. Firms will be ranked based on 2024 revenues for work done within the recently merged Mountain States & Southwest region, which includes Arizona, Colorado, Idaho, New Mexico, Montana, Utah and Wyoming. Denver City Council voted Monday to move forward an intergovernmental agreement (IGA) between the city and the Broadway Station Metropolitan District Number 1 by spending $70 million on land acquisition and improvements that will enable construction to get underway on a 14,500-seat stadium for the city’s new National Women’s Soccer League team.

Jennyfer LaBuff38, Director of Data Engineering and Application DevelopmentSundt ConstructionTempe, Ariz. Recruited to Sundt in 2012 by a former colleague, LaBuff steadily advanced through multiple promotions and increased responsibilities to her current role leading a team that manages the contractor’s data enterprise-wide. From the Tempe office, LaBuff spearheads efforts to enhance data security and quality while improving data literacy across the firm.

Grisel GrayTeaches estimating classes in Spanish while pursuing a doctoral degreeDirector of Preconstruction & EstimatingGilmore Construction Corp. Growing up, Grisel Gray was drawn to math, science and puzzles. But it wasn’t until a fellow student at the University of Nebraska-Lincoln suggested she take a construction class that she discovered her passion. “I was instantly hooked,” she says, and changed her chemical engineering track to construction management.

House Bill 25-1272, sent to Gov. Jared Polis for signature at the conclusion of Colorado's legislative session May 7, seeks to incentivize builders to construct much-needed multifamily housing through a program that makes construction defect liability insurance more attractive by lowering premiums for builders.

ENR Mountain States and Southwest has selected Affiliated Engineers Inc. (AEI) as Southwest Design Firm of the Year. The firm experienced 46% growth in the Southwest last year and 35% in the larger region while doubling its engineering-led business and leveraging data and technology on several high-profile regional projects. Firms of the Year are chosen by a vote of the regional ENR editors from across the country based on a carefully selected group of finalists.

ENR Mountain States and Southwest has selected Westwood Professional Services as Design Firm of the Year for Colorado and Wyoming. The firm reported revenue growth of 30% across its more than 30 locations in 2024 and expanded its workforce by close to 20%.
